Topics include the simplex method, network flow methods, branch and bound and cutting plane methods for discrete optimization. The method adopts the birth and death process to analyze the system performance of heterogeneous networks, fully considers users mobility and then obtains network joint utility optimization. Stochastic optimization refers to a collection of methods for minimizing or maximizing an objective function when randomness is present. Sep 27, 20 faced with the rise of solidstate drives, which dont require defragmentation, defragmentation software companies have dipped their toes into the ssd optimization software waters. Born just about 20 years ago as a disruptive technology for topology optimization of structures, optistruct has matured into altairs structural analysis and optimization solver solution for linear and nonlinear structural problems under static and dynamic loadings. Barrier methods of birth control block sperm from entering the uterus. Search engine optimization is greatly related as a result of it puts your website on the map, where the various search engines would immediately see it and should you study intently the various techniques and methods of fundamental seo, the common goal is to make the web site known to the search engines and finally land on a positive ranking on. Motions of industrial manipulators and other robots, including legged robots animals many mechanics problems using some variant of. Here we provide some guidance to help you classify your optimization model. In some cases source code may not be available, some authors only supply executables for special systems. Portfolio optimization in r using a genetic algorithm.
For this, it is necessary to optimize the working of a system, minimizing or maximizing one of its many objectives or performance criteria. The labor optimization model gives our customer new perspective on futurestate labor scheduling. International journal on evolutionary optimization. Specific methods such as linear programming and quadratic programming are more efficient than the general methods in solving the problems because they are tailored for it. These methods, combined with more detailed and accurate simulation methods, are the primary ways we have, short of actually building. Mathematical analytical, numerical and optimization models are employed in many disciplines including the water resources planning, engineering and management. In the deterministic optimization setting, quasinewton methods are more robust and achieve higher accuracy than gradient methods, because they use approximate secondorder derivative information. Optimization methods optimization methods are designed to provide the best values of system design and operating policy variables values that will lead to the highest levels of system performance. Fortran, matlab, and python software for sparse symmetric linear equations \ax b\, where \a\ is definite or indefinite. The software may alternatively be used under the terms of a bsd license bsdlicense. The human races preferences and proclivities are a moving target.
Theoretical studies with a clear potential for applicability, as well as successful applications of optimization methods and software in specific areas such as engineering, machine learning, data mining, economics, finance, biology, or medicine. Optimization techniques in matlab matlab and simulink. Back to constrained optimization or continuous optimization. Specialization tools and techniques for systematic optimization of. The barrier method then blocks any remaining sperm from passing through the cervix to fertilize an egg. Emphasis is on methodology and the underlying mathematical structures. Benchmarking derivativefree optimization algorithms. Those who are interested in receiving more information on the conference, please contact. Optimization methods and software guide 2 research. This allows you to implement advanced methods in the same intuitive manner as with all analytica models. Product optimization or product testing decision analyst. A comparison of optimization methods and software for. An optimization algorithm is a procedure which is executed iteratively by comparing various solutions till an optimum or a satisfactory solution is found. Our software is the overwhelming favorite tool for teaching mba students about these methods, in a thousand universities worldwide.
The main topics are the same as those covered by the journal publications. Methods and software sven leyfferyand ashutosh mahajan z march 17, 2010 abstract we survey the foundations of nonlinearly constrained optimization methods. Before sending a scientific article, we recommend you to read the section for authors. Exact optimization methods that guarantee finding an optimal solution and heuristic. The following software packages are provided by sol under the terms of the mit license mit. Linear and integer, and their applications to compressed sensing, data mining, and pattern classification.
Software optimization methods of changing a software. You can use the toolbox solvers to find optimal solutions to continuous and discrete problems, perform tradeoff analyses, and incorporate optimization methods into algorithms and applications. This course introduces the principal algorithms for linear, network, discrete, nonlinear, dynamic optimization and optimal control. Development of an optimization method and software for. This is particularly important for operational problems, where the solution to the optimization problem specifies a shortterm assignment or schedule of resource use. Optimization methods and software publishes refereed papers on the latest developments in the theory and realization of optimization methods, with particular emphasis on the interface between software development and algorithm design. Abstract largescale linear classification is widely used in many areas.
Over the last few decades these methods have become essential tools for science, engineering, business, computer science, and statistics. This list may not reflect recent changes learn more. Browse the list of issues and latest articles from optimization methods and software. The toolbox lets you perform design optimization tasks, including parameter estimation, component selection, and parameter tuning. The l1regularized form can be applied for feature selection. Theory, implementation and performance evaluation of algorithms and computer codes for linear. The book contains a comprehensive presentation of methods for unconstrained and constrained optimization problems. Optimization methods and software submit an article journal homepage. In any case, observe the expressed or implied license conditions. The situation is different if problems are nphard as then exact optimization methods need exponential effort. Conference chair for the 1st international conference on optimization methods and software 1518.
If you still use pen and paper to plan your routes, youre making last mile delivery harder than it needs to be. Gill of the university of california san diego and walter murray and michael a. Optimization method an overview sciencedirect topics. The process optimization solution uses a unique layered approach to advanced control and optimization. The 4th conference on optimization methods and software, part ii december 16 20, 2017, havana, cuba. Structural optimization methods and techniques to design. In this paper we present design optimization method that can be integrated very a easily to any simulationbased design process. Mathematical optimization alternatively spelt optimisation or mathematical programming is the selection of a best element with regard to some criterion from some set of available alternatives. The birth and death process enhanced optimization algorithm. Jan 10, 20 optimization methods have been applied to a wide variety of problems in healthcare ranging from operational level scheduling decisions to the design of national healthcare policies.
The idea is that solidstate drives require a program on your computer to optimize them so they can run at their top speed, but theres no real evidence. You can define your optimization problem with functions and matrices or by specifying variable expressions that reflect the underlying mathematics. Interpret the output from the solver and diagnose the progress of an optimization. These methods need to be integrated into one framework to reveal the connection among them and compare their advantages and weaknesses. Optimization methods and software rg journal impact. Optimization methods for computational statistics and data analysis stephen wright university of wisconsinmadison samsi optimization opening workshop, august 2016 wright uwmadison optimization in data analysis august 2016 1 64. Optimization methods for computational statistics and data. Woodworking optimization software top woodworking plans.
Given a transformation between input and output values, described by a mathematical function f, optimization deals with generating and selecting a best solution. In computer science, program optimization or software optimization is the process of modifying. The optimization software will deliver input values in a, the software module realizing f will deliver the computed value f x and, in some cases, additional. Software optimization methods of changing a software system 784 words 4 pages hw 4 software optimization techniques software optimization is process of changing a software system to enable some aspect of the process to work more efficiently using less memory storage and less power. Polyak department of seor and mathematical sciences department, george mason university, fairfax,virginia, usa received 5 june 2006. Abstract this chapter describes how optimization problems can be solved and which different types of optimization methods exist for discrete optimization problems. Lecture notes optimization methods sloan school of. Sqopt may also be used for linear programming and for finding a feasible point for a set of linear equalities and inequalities. The availability of realtime status information is creating a need for reoptimization models and methods that can quickly repair a plan in response to changes in input data. Plexis offers a host of business services, including program software optimization, performance tuning, and other aspects of performance analysis. In this paper, different optimization methods and techniques that can be used to address some of these issues are discussed. Optimization methods for applications in statistics.
The engagement led to a series of manual field tests, where the currentstate labor system is being substituted with new configurations of shift lengths and staffing levels. Apr 29, 2020 the 4th conference on optimization methods and software, part ii december 1620, 2017, havana, cuba. Naamkaran vedic method this part of the software will help you pick appropriate and lucky baby names depending on the time, date of birth and other important data. We can distinguish between two different types of optimization methods. The general form of a nonlinear programming problem is to minimize a scalarvalued function \f\ of several variables \x\ subject to other functions constraints that limit or define the values of the variables. Usually, an exact optimization method is the method of choice if it can solve an optimization problem with effort that grows polynomially with the problem size. How to select the right optimization method for your problem. More than any other vendor, weve made optimization easy to use by smart people who arent specialists in operations research or management science. The spermicide kills most of the sperm that enter the vagina. Recently, development and employment of modern optimization methods moms have become popular in the. Volume 35 2020 volume 34 2019 volume 33 2018 volume 32 2017 volume 31 2016 volume 30 2015 volume 29 2014 volume 28 20 volume 27 2012 volume 26 2011 volume 25 2010.
Tomlab supports global optimization, integer programming, all types of least squares, linear, quadratic and unconstrained programming for. Quasinewton methods usually employ the following updates for solving 1. After the connection has been made such that the optimization software can talk to the engineering model, we specify the. This neos optimization guide provides information about the field of optimization and many of its subdisciplines. Optimization techniques and applications with examples wiley. Naamkaran western method this part of the software will also help you pick out baby names, but based on the techniques and methods followed by the western. The main strength of the book is the precise convergence analysis of most nonlinear programming algorithms presented, and it is especially comprehensive for line search, newton, quasinewton, trust region and sqp methods. The 4th conference on optimization methods and software, part ii december 1620, 2017, havana, cuba. Delivery route planning involves accurately correlating between drivers, available vehicle types, and the delivery windows promised to customers.
The focus of the content is on the resources available for solving optimization problems, including the solvers available on the neos server. Topics include the simplex method, network flow methods, branch and bound and cutting plane methods for discrete optimization, optimality conditions for nonlinear optimization, interior point. Industrial engineering ie optimization methods for data analytics, optimization modeling languages such as ampl and gams, and optimization software including the neos server. Several commercial software packages that implement optimization methods are capable to plot a surface and find optimal solutions, but they focus exclusively. Sqopt sparse quadratic optimizer is a software package for minimizing a convex quadratic function subject to both equality and inequality constraints. Researchers in the center for computational mathematics group at the uc san diego and in the systems optimization laboratory at stanford university research and develop numerical optimization software for academic, research, and commercial use. Computational optimization and applications covers a wide range of topics in optimization, including. With the advent of computers, optimization has become a part of computeraided design activities. Cuttingedge program software optimization services plexis has an outstanding record delivering horizontal and vertical scaling, incorporating disparate systems to create a higher synergy value. Since the birth of modern portfolio theory mpt by harry markowitz, many scientists have studied a. Aug 27, 2017 theoretical studies with a clear potential for applicability, as well as successful applications of optimization methods and software in specific areas such as engineering, machine learning, data mining, economics, finance, biology, or medicine. Thats why product testing and optimization must be viewed as a strategic, ongoing activity.
Edited by oleg burdakov and tamas terlaky original articles. The optimization module will compute the exact analytic derivative of your objective and constraint functions using the adjoint method of the snopt optimizer, developed by philip e. Empirical and theoretical comparisons of several nonsmooth minimization methods and software. For many optimization methods, and especially for modern heuristics, there is a tradeoff between solution quality and effort, as with increasing effort solution quality increases. Volume 35 2020 volume 34 2019 volume 33 2018 volume 32 2017 volume 31 2016 volume 30 2015 volume 29 2014 volume 28. Algorithms and software for convex mixed integer nonlinear programs. Most work uses optimization methods to site health care facilities to maximize service coverage, minimize travel needs of patients, limit the number of facilities, maximize health, or combine some of these goals. Optimization methods and software publishes refereed papers on the latest developments in the theory and realization of optimization methods, with particular emphasis on the interface between.
For an alphabetical listing of all of the linked pages, see optimization problem types. Using a spermicide with a barrier method gives you the best possible barrier method protection. Optimization institute for mathematics and its applications. Increase accuracy and efficiency of an optimization by changing settings. Optimization problems of sorts arise in all quantitative disciplines from computer science and engineering to operations research and economics, and the development of solution methods has. Optimization methods sloan school of management mit. Measurement, optimization, and impact of health care. These models can vary from a simple blackbox model to a sophisticated distributed physicsbased model. Special attention is paid on software implementation issues of the proposed method.
The supply chain is the process of manufacturing finished products from natural resources, raw materials, and components and the delivery of the. If you are in search of software for your problem you will find as far as possible public domain or freeforresearch software. Research is often a slow process, requiring the careful design, optimization, and replication of experiments. Conference on optimization methods and software 2017 home. The conference is organized in relation to the 25th anniversary of the journal optimization methods and software oms observed in 2017. Optimization methods are somewhat generic in nature in that many methods work for wide variety of problems.
The topology optimization method deals with the problem of determining the optimal layout of material and connectivity inside a design domain in. Saunders of stanford university, to improve the design variables. The testing environment real environment testing i. Maximize efficiency with delivery route optimization software. The goal of optimization methods is to find an optimal or nearoptimal solution with low computational effort. Analyticas core features, including monte carlo sampling, intelligent arrays, and dynamic definitions, are all compatible with optimization. Routific is a route optimization software platform that helps delivery businesses plan their routes more efficiently, saving them time and up to 40% on fuel. Pages in category optimization algorithms and methods the following 161 pages are in this category, out of 161 total. Nov 17, 2018 portfolio optimization is one of the most interesting fields of study of financial mathematics. A guide to modern optimization applications and techniques in newly emerging areas spanning optimization, data science, machine intelligence, engineering, and computer sciences optimization techniques and applications with examples introduces the fundamentals of all the commonly used techniquesin optimization that encompass the broadness and diversity of the methods traditional and. Generally optimization methods can be classified into general methods and methods tailored for a specific class of problems. This model allows new technologies to be easily added at any time to a common platform that meets optimization objectives without compromising on future opportunities to improve business performance. Methods such as sizing, shape, topology, topometry, topography and freeform optimization are described and examples. Modern optimization methods in water resources planning.
In the last decades, software architecture optimization methods, which aim to automate the search for an optimal architecture design with respect to a set of. On the other hand, platformdependent techniques involve instruction scheduling, instructionlevel parallelism, datalevel parallelism, cache. Optimization methods are techniques that enable us to solve optimization problems. Use global optimization toolbox functionality to solve problems where classical algorithms fail or work inefficiently. Given a transformation between input and output values, described by a mathematical function. The main subject areas of published articles are software, applied mathematics, control and optimization. There are two distinct types of optimization algorithms widely used today. The scientific journal optimization methods and software is included in the scopus database. The use of optimization software requires that the function f is defined in a suitable programming language and connected at compile or run time to the optimization software. Birth and maturation of a disruptive technology april 21, 2014 about jeff brennan since joining altair in 1992 as an engineering consultant, jeff has served a variety of technical and business roles, including program manager for altairs optimization products, director of sales and marketing, and vice. Surrogatemodel based method and software for practical.
1380 1304 189 1276 336 1217 742 846 1507 67 567 1016 477 1592 1506 681 1577 1516 258 1043 1355 169 159 1089 692 517 389 1208 1384